Frequently asked questions

Do you need planning permission to demolish a building?
Most demolition outside conservation areas is permitted development under Part 11 of the GPDO, but you must submit a prior-approval application covering method and restoration. Demolition of dwellinghouses always needs prior approval, even where permitted development applies.
What is a 'replacement dwelling' application?
Planning permission to demolish an existing dwelling and replace it with a new one. The principle is not automatic — councils assess the replacement against local policy on impact, scale, design and any heritage or rural-character considerations.
